X-Git-Url: http://info.iut-bm.univ-fcomte.fr/pub/gitweb/simgrid.git/blobdiff_plain/e982dff5ebe26bbe6ecfa999fd89a2fe406ad26b..bc0010abcda73a601f75f7c96fc1cc09918ee2cd:/include/simgrid/jedule/jedule.hpp diff --git a/include/simgrid/jedule/jedule.hpp b/include/simgrid/jedule/jedule.hpp deleted file mode 100644 index d89c9a3a71..0000000000 --- a/include/simgrid/jedule/jedule.hpp +++ /dev/null @@ -1,39 +0,0 @@ -/* Copyright (c) 2010-2021. The SimGrid Team. All rights reserved. */ - -/* This program is free software; you can redistribute it and/or modify it - * under the terms of the license (GNU LGPL) which comes with this package. */ - -#ifndef JEDULE_HPP_ -#define JEDULE_HPP_ - -#include -#include -#include - -#include - -namespace simgrid { -namespace jedule{ - -class XBT_PUBLIC Jedule { - std::unordered_map meta_info_; - std::vector event_set_; - Container root_container_; - -public: - explicit Jedule(const std::string& name) : root_container_(name) - { - root_container_.create_hierarchy(s4u::Engine::get_instance()->get_netzone_root()); - } - void add_meta_info(char* key, char* value); - void add_event(const Event& event); - void cleanup_output(); - void write_output(FILE* file); -}; - -} // namespace jedule -} // namespace simgrid - -using jedule_t = simgrid::jedule::Jedule*; - -#endif /* JEDULE_HPP_ */